High block (green wall) construction

It is a simple "earth" structure that expands hybrid cells and stacks them in a stepped manner.

External forces are calculated as a "retaining wall" integrated with the soil pressure from the trial rust method and the frictional forces acting between layers. The slope of the slope (retaining wall) is the setback amount of the stairs, making it easy to change the slope and construct curved sections. The flexible structure of the hybrid cell construction allows for the end points to be pressed against the ground throughout the construction process.

High Block 900

This is a large block that can be used as a buffer material for road construction work zones, as well as for lane separation and lane narrowing at toll booths.

It is possible to restore the direction of travel during a contact collision. To enhance visibility from the vehicle, the height is set at 900mm.

High Block 500

This is a medium-sized block that can be used as a buffer material for road construction work zones, as well as for lane separation and lane narrowing at toll booths.

It is possible to restore the direction of travel during contact collisions. It has the effect of alleviating congestion and facilitating smooth vehicle flow at places like highway toll booths and road construction sites. When ETC lanes are parallel to existing lanes, they are installed as guiding lanes. Additionally, changes to the guiding lanes in response to fluctuations in the number of users can be made promptly. It also serves as a boundary for vehicle entry prohibition areas, acting as a divider for parks, walkways, and shopping districts.
